Eastern Market, Detroit, MI

...I go most Saturdays pretty much year round and love every visit, from the flowers, asparagus and morels of early spring, to the cornucopia of fruits and vegetable of summer, the apples, pumpkins and squashes of fall and the local meats of winter. And it is fun, for it is a truly democratic market, with city hipsters shopping next to newly arrived Yemeni immigrants, and people seeking good food prices shopping side by side with some of the city's most commited foodies. It is great (and delicious) fun, do not miss it.

The Detroit Institute of Art

..one of America's great museums. The Diego Rivera murals alone make it a must. It has many world class collections, hosts a fantastic film series and great temporary exhibits.

Detroit Zoo

...I volunteer at the zoo, it is a great place to spend a day with the animals, rain or shine. You can have breakfast with the giraffes, go underwater at the Arctic Ring of Life exhibit, walk in the butterfly garden...so much to do! Come visit us.

Pewabic Pottery, Detroit

...it's a world famous site known for its pottery and glazes. They have exhibits, a wonderful gift shop and classes for novices to world-class potters. A great place to visit!
